Output 72c2c39225c05892e39525e3b82184ad99ba85ead1f40f72d868dea8811e9083:7

value
23460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facb3756b9f72703cfa0dc76a70f95ac9a104190 OP_EQUAL
address
MWmEc6SYeziQjhspEspVCycqskNTohqd2R
transaction
72c2c39225c05892e39525e3b82184ad99ba85ead1f40f72d868dea8811e9083
spent
true